Output 3d70f27b172063befbde49b73f0db1c20c3996ea75b42d8830f4c2dd8461a4e5:0

value
593526
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28ef486b81a096eff32b56f6f1a37fa44f5f71aa OP_EQUAL
address
35RTbtCuAHfTbm2fRaVNsKa29UyHq3fr6V
transaction
3d70f27b172063befbde49b73f0db1c20c3996ea75b42d8830f4c2dd8461a4e5
spent
true